SH’CHEM AND DINAH
Genesis 34

1Dinah batLeah–whom she bore to Ya’aqov–went out to see the daughters of the land. 2Sh’chem benChamor–the Chivi, noble of the land–he saw her and he took her and he laid her and he diminished her. 
3His soul clung to Dinah batYa’aqov. He loved the girl. He spoke to her heart. 4Sh’chem said to Chamor, his father, “Take this child to be woman for me.”
5When Ya’aqov heard that he had defiled his daughter Dinah, his sons were in the field with his flocks. He kept silent till their arrival.
6Chamor, father of Sh’chem, went out to Ya’aqov to speak with him. 7Ya’aqov’s sons, when they heard, came from the field. The men were pained and very angry, for he had done folly with Yisra’el, to lay the daughter of Ya’aqov. Such must not be done.
8Chamor spoke with them, “Sh’chem my son, his soul is passionate for your daughter. Give her to him to be woman. 9Intermarry with us. Give us your daughters and take our daughters for yourselves. 10Settle with us and the land shall be before you. Settle or move about in it, possess it.”
11Sh’chem said to her father and her brothers, “I’ll find favor in your eyes. Whatever you say to me, I’ll give. 12Raise high, very high a bride price. A gift. I’ll give whatever you say to me, but give me the girl as woman.”
13The b’neyYa’aqov responded to Sh’chem and Chamor his father, but they spoke with deceit for he had defiled  their sister Dinah. 14They said, “We cannot do this thing, to give our sister to a man who has a foreskin. Because for us it is an object of scorn. 15Only with this shall we consent with you: if you become like us in circumcising yourselves, every male. 16Then we’ll give you our daughters and take your daughters for ourselves. We’ll settle with you and become one people. 17And if you do not listen to us to circumcise, then we’ll take our daughter and go.”
18Their words were good in the eyes of Chamor and his son Sh’chem. 19The boy did not delay in doing the thing, for he desired Ya’aqov’s daughter, and he was the most honored of all his father’s house.
20Then Chamor came, and his son Sh’chem to the gate of their city and spoke to the men of their city: 21“These men are peaceable with us. They’ll dwell in the land and move about. The land, behold, offers broad reach before them. We’ll take their daughters as women for ourselves and give them our daughters. 22Only with this will the men consent to us, to dwell with us, to become one people: in our circumcising every male, as they are circumcised. 23Then their acquired livestock, all their cattle, won’t all be ours? Only let us consent to them and they will dwell among us.”
24All who go out the gate of his city listened to Chamor and his son Sh’chem and every male was circumcised, all who go out the gate. 25Then, on the third day, when they were aching, two of Ya’aqov’s sons, Shim’on and Levi, brothers of Dinah, took each his sword. They came confidently upon the city and killed every male. 26Chamor and his son Sh’chem, they killed by the mouth of the sword and they took Dinah from Sh’chem’s house and left.
27When the b’neyYa’aov came upon the corpses they plundered the city that had defiled their sister. 28Their flock, their herd, their asses, whatever was in the city or in the field, they took. 29They returned and plundered all their wealth, all their children and women, all that was in the house.
30Ya’aqov said to Shim’on and Levi, “You have made trouble for me in bringing me a stench before the K’na’ani and P’rizi residents of the land. I am few in men. They can gather against me and strike me. I could be destroyed, I and my house.”

31 They said, “Should they treat our sister like a whore?”
